Jersey Police have arrested a 22 year old man in connection with an attempted robbery at Morrisons on Queen's Road.
A masked man entered the store and threatened a cashier, but was chased away by a customer and left with nothing.
Detectives are still appealing for sightings or dash cam footage of the suspect in the area between 6.30-7pm last Friday evening (12 January).
He was wearing a black balaclava/ski mask, a black long-sleeved top with grey patterned/camouflage arms, grey camouflaged trousers, brown boots and black gloves. He was also carrying a white plastic bag.
